Senior Vietnamese Party Leader to Visit Cambodia to Boost Bilateral Cooperation
AKP Phnom Penh, April 07, 2026 --
H.E. Tran Cam Tu, Member of the Politburo and Permanent Member of the Secretariat of the Communist Party of Vietnam (CPV) Central Committee, will pay an official visit to the Kingdom of Cambodia from April 9 to 10, 2026, according to a press release issued by the Central Committee of the Cambodian People’s Party (CPP) on Monday.
The visit will be made at the invitation of Samdech Vibol Sena Pheakdei Say Chhum, Vice President of the CPP and Chairman of the Standing Committee of the CPP Central Committee.
According to the statement, the visit holds significant diplomatic and political importance as it aims to follow up on the outcomes of the high-level meeting between the CPP and the CPV held on Feb. 6, 2026.
It also seeks to advance the implementation of agreements on delegation exchanges between the two parties, in line with the shared principles of “good neighbourliness, traditional friendship, comprehensive cooperation, and long-term stability.”
The visit is expected to further strengthen cooperation across a wide range of sectors, including diplomacy, national defence, security, economy, trade, investment, science and technology, digital transformation, education, tourism, and people-to-people exchanges.
During his stay, H.E. Tran Cam Tu is scheduled to hold courtesy meetings and working discussions with CPP's senior leaders, as well as with leaders of the Senate, the National Assembly, and the Royal Government of Cambodia.
